Art of the Warden allows one to control the ebb and flow of magical energy inside one's body only (the moment this control extends outside the person's body it more-or-less becomes necromancy), so the whole sending-pulses-of-energy-through-opponent-when-you-hit... They can't do that. They can only enhance themselves. Nor can they change their form (as per the Third Law of Magic: The Spirits' Work Cannot Be Undone) such as sharpening nails or making an entire hand sharp. It can enable one to make one's nails and hand stronger, more rigid and durable, allowing one to tear and crash through things and people, but not cut. Arcane magic, on the other hand, could achieve something along those lines... It could sharpen the nails (though not un-sharpen them easily, and doing so would have about the same effect as actually manually sharpening them) and create sort of a magical cutting-edge around the hand, though the latter would require a disproportionally huge amount of energy compared to what one gains (it would function by pretty much compressing air to the extreme until it would form an invisible cutting edge - something that is extremely exhausting), but it is not possible to do it through the Art.
